Types of Betting Odds Explained

When engaging in online betting, it is essential to understand the three main types of odds:

  • Fractional Odds: Commonly used in the UK, fractional odds represent the profit relative to the stake. For example, 5/1 means you win $5 for every $1 wagered.
  • Decimal Odds: Used widely in Europe, decimal odds show the total payout (stake + profit) for each dollar wagered. For example, odds of 2.00 mean that for every dollar wagered, you receive $2 back.
  • Moneyline Odds: Primarily used in the US, moneyline odds indicate how much you need to wager to win $100 (for positive odds) or how much you can win from a $100 wager (for negative odds).

Common Mistakes in Interpreting Odds

Many gamblers fall into traps when interpreting betting odds, leading to poor decision-making:

  • Overvaluing Favorites: Betting heavily on favorites often leads to lower returns and unexpected losses in high-stake situations.
  • Ignoring External Factors: Weather conditions, player injuries, and team dynamics can significantly influence game outcomes. Always consider these before placing bets.
  • Not Shop for Odds: Many fall into the routine of using the same bookmaker. However, exploring various platforms can yield better odds.

Bankroll Management for Beginners

Bankroll management is critical for both novice and experienced gamblers. Here are some key strategies:

  • Set a Budget: Determine your total bankroll and decide how much you can afford to risk on individual bets.
  • Use a Betting Percentage: A common strategy is to wager 1-5% of your bankroll on a single bet, which helps mitigate risks associated with losses.
  • Track Your Bets: Keep a record of your bets, noting wins, losses, and strategies. This data can help refine future betting practices.

Recognizing Problem Gambling Signs

Awareness of problem gambling signs can help mitigate risk:

  • Preoccupation with betting, long after a session is over.
  • Chasing losses or betting more than intended to win back lost funds.
  • Feeling anxious or distressed about gambling activities.
